Transaction 358316596965f59efca1dcaf91e2d05a3b241aa4b699116202b4ba76b7f08228

1 Input
2 Outputs
  • 358316596965f59efca1dcaf91e2d05a3b241aa4b699116202b4ba76b7f08228:0
  • value  773966948
    address  37UmWw8rQpmomsHmq62AiE6EXgbi59UFAe
  • 358316596965f59efca1dcaf91e2d05a3b241aa4b699116202b4ba76b7f08228:1
  • value  193485644
    address  3HYxkBcpGKRqKosHKfwa5QLnsmhrNfCUix